How to Choose the Right Songs for Instagram Story
Here are some tips to pick the best song for your Insta story so your content can stand out from the crowd:

- A/B Test Your Soundtracks — Try out different songs in your Story. For example, a fashion influencer could do a Get Ready With Me with an upbeat Dua Lipa track. Then, post a “Haul” with a less popular song. Check your insights to see which one hits better.
- Create a Signature Music Palette — Try to find specific micro-moods and choose unique songs that match them. For example, a vlogger sharing morning stories might use ambient piano like Gymnopédie No. 1. For travel videos, artists like Khruangbin has songs that add a lively vibe.
- Choose the Best Part for Dramatic Impact — Focus on the most impactful 15 seconds of a song, like a fitness influencer highlighting the high-energy “My anaconda don’t..” from Nicki Minaj’s “Anaconda.” This catchy part pairs with quick visuals to instantly boost the vibe.
- Poll Your Audience for Music Insights — Use Instagram’s poll sticker to ask your followers the music they love. It’s a quick way to get them involved and pick the perfect song. For example, if you’re a beauty influencer about to do a bold makeup tutorial, ask, “Which song for this look?”
- Match Lyrics to Your Narrative — Pick songs for Instagram story with lyrics that tell a story or match your message. For example, “Unstoppable” by Sia works well if you want to share a message of confidence, like “I’m unstoppable today.”
- Highlight Your Personal Brand — Pick best songs for your Instagram stories that match your personality. If your brand is about positivity and resilience, Eminem’s “Lose Yourself” fits well. Focus on the guitar riffs and the line, “If you have one shot, one opportunity.”
- Make Sure Your Music Is Available — The last thing you want is an Instagram story song that’s blocked in some regions. Hits like Lady Gaga’s “Born This Way” was banned in certain countries. So, pick your songs wisely for better reach.
